Day 13 (cont)

Rambling on down the road we came upon another Tai home. Several women with their children had gathered to talk and share work while the men were in the fields.


The husband was working on a plank that he was using to make a door. His homemade bow saw was sharp and he was making good progress.


He showed us his most recent project, a vanity shelf. The joints were tight and well joined. Every bit as good as I could make in my modem work shop back home.


Next stop a small coffee field with corn and the occasional banana interspersed with the coffee plants. No inch of ground wasted seems to be the motto.


Nearby we found a hair buyer. Wing says a good head of hair brings in big bucks. He also says some of the Tai hair buns aren't real since some women have sold their hair and wear a false bun.
